ホームページ >Java >&#&チュートリアル >Java のカプセル化と継承の実践ガイド: コードを最適化して効率を高める
Java のカプセル化と継承は、オブジェクト指向プログラミングにおける重要な概念であり、適切に使用すると、コード構造を最適化し、コードの再利用性と保守性を向上させることができます。実際のプロジェクト開発では、カプセル化と継承を正しく使用する方法は、プログラマーが深く理解して習得する必要があるスキルです。この記事では、PHP エディター Baicao が、Java でのカプセル化と継承の使用方法とテクニックの詳細な分析を提供します。これにより、これら 2 つの機能を有効に活用してコードを最適化し、開発効率を向上させることができます。
カプセル化
カプセル化は、クラス内のデータとメソッドをバンドルすることでクラスの内部実装を隠します。これには次の利点があります:
パッケージ戦略の最適化
継承
継承により、あるクラス (サブクラス) が別のクラス (親クラス) からデータとメソッドを継承できるようになります。これには次の利点があります:
継承戦略の最適化
カプセル化と継承の組み合わせを最適化する
カプセル化と継承を組み合わせることで、次の利点が得られます。
単一責任の原則に従います: 可読性と保守性を向上させるために、各クラスは単一の責任を担当する必要があります。
カプセル化と継承を効果的に適用することで、開発者は保守可能で再利用可能で効率的なコードを作成できます。パブリック メソッドの最小化、過剰な継承の回避、継承動作のテストなどのベスト プラクティスに従うと、コードをさらに最適化し、アプリケーションの全体的な効率を向上させることができます。
以上がJava のカプセル化と継承の実践ガイド: コードを最適化して効率を高めるの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。